Systemic virus infection impairs the steady state of auxin hormone in plant with consequent morphogenetic alterations. Most reports indicate a reduction of auxin activity in diseased plants, generally associated with stunting, but a substantial increase in auxin activity has sometimes been observed in cases of severe symptomatology. Treatments of virus-diseased plants with exogenous auxins may inhibit virus replication and reduce symptom severity, although results have been obtained by empirical application and must therefore be considered with caution. There is no information on how virus infection alters auxin metabolism or how this alteration affects both plant growth and development. The considerable progress reached in auxin biochemistry now allows more accurate re-investigations of this important relationship.
